Canal Head, Pocklington
Canal Head, Pocklington
The canal is kept full by inflow from Pocklington Beck, which in turn will be fed by springs on the foothills of the Wolds.

The canal has unusable sections, so no boats this high. However, see LinkExternal link for local information.
